Corporate bonds, where to buy early and where to pay late

Many businesses are still slow in paying bonds to investors. For example, Dua Fat Group Joint Stock Company (DFF) has just announced a resolution of bondholders allowing the company to extend the payment of principal and interest on bonds with an outstanding debt of VND111.9 billion that are overdue. Accordingly, bondholders agreed to let DFF pay a total of VND25.62 billion in principal and interest on bonds (including VND22.38 billion in principal and VND3.24 billion in interest) on March 1. The applicable interest rate is 11.75%. After March 1, DFF will only have to pay interest without having to pay the principal, but the overdue interest rate will increase to 17.625%/year.

From June 15, 2023 to July 14, 2023, DFF must pay both principal and interest at an interest rate of 17.625%. In case DFF fails to implement the committed payment schedule, the bondholder will handle the collateral of the bond DFFH2123001.

Many businesses still buy back bonds before maturity

The situation of many enterprises being late in paying bonds is still happening like DFF. For example, at the end of February, Ho Chi Minh City Service and Trading Joint Stock Company (Setra) sent a document to the Hanoi Stock Exchange (HNX) to notify about the late payment of principal and interest on bonds. It is known that Setra has 20 bond codes with a total issuance value of VND2,000 billion, with the same interest payment date on February 28. The total interest to be paid is more than VND104 billion. However, Setra announced that it could not pay any money to bondholders because it could not arrange a payment source.

Or Hung Thinh Quy Nhon Entertainment Services Joint Stock Company has a bond lot with code HQNCH2124005 due for interest payment, with a total issuance value of 1,600 billion VND. According to the plan, the company will pay interest on February 27 with an amount of nearly 45 billion VND. However, in reality, the company only paid interest with an amount of more than 22 billion VND and the interest. The reason given by the company is that it could not arrange the money source in time to pay due to the context of tight credit, unfavorable developments in the real estate transaction market...

But on the other hand, businesses also bought back quite a lot of bonds. For example, Vinh Son - Song Hinh Hydropower Joint Stock Company (VSH) announced that it would buy back bonds issued from the first to the fifth batch in 2019 before maturity. Specifically, VSH will buy back 111 bonds with the code VSH_BOND_2019 with 5 issuances from 1 to 5 years. The total value of bonds bought back before maturity at par value is VND111 billion. Previously, VSH announced that it had bought back VND108 billion worth of bonds before maturity from February 28 to March 7.

According to the Vietnam Bond Association (VBMA), the total value of bonds bought back by businesses before maturity in February was VND5,940 billion, up 34% over the same period last year. Since the beginning of the year, the total value of bonds bought back by businesses has reached more than VND15,300 billion, up 43% over the same period in 2022.

In March, the total value of corporate bonds maturing was VND 17,700 billion, more than 3 times higher than the value maturing in February. According to data from VNDirect Securities Company, the estimated value of corporate bonds maturing in 2023 is about VND 252,000 billion, an increase of 64% compared to 2022. In which, the period of Q2 - Q3/2023 is considered quite challenging with nearly VND 160,000 billion of bonds maturing.

The real estate business group accounts for the largest proportion with 43% of the total maturity value of individual bonds in 2023, equivalent to VND 107,700 billion. Followed by the finance - banking group with 31% of the maturity value, equivalent to VND 77,600 billion (up 24% compared to 2022)...
